Lord Darzi’s Investigation of the NHS

In July 2024, the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care commissioned Lord Darzi to carry out an immediate, independent investigation of the NHS. The report aimed to provide expert insight into the NHS’s performance across England and the challenges facing the healthcare system, drawing on available data and intelligence.
